This is a very nice 69 T&C. This car is loaded with power windows, that all work, Rear A/C, and lots of others. This car is very solid and runs great. Would need a little work to be a daily driver, but not much. Has a 440 auto and an 8 3/4 rear. Would be a great car to haul your race car around. Asking $3900 with clear OR title.
